I note daily mail says 'Fenland least happy' maybe...but I'd think thats a quirk of the lifestyle people have to lead there. Fenland is where Cambridge sources its low wage low skill workers from, given the university stridently prevents much residential development in Cambridge. So you have the poorest workers paying the most in time and money to commute to a job. Not unusual to spend 2-3 hours commuting from the Fens to Cambridge every day. Roads are terrible. Housing gets built by the thousand. People assume congestion is just an urban thing, but with the beet lorries, farm machinery and mass of commuters on fenland roads, half of which are flooded in the winter...it must get people down. 0 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
